Image Processing Module Market CAGR 10.9% by 2034
Global Image Processing Module Market, valued at a robust US$ 7316 million in 2024, is on a trajectory of significant expansion, projected to reach US$ 13680 million by 2032. This growth, representing a compound annual growth rate (CAGR) of 10.9%, is detailed in a comprehensive new report published by Semiconductor Insight. The study highlights the critical role of these specialized computational devices in enabling real-time analysis, automation, and intelligence across a multitude of high-tech industries.
Image processing modules, essential for converting raw pixel data into actionable insights, are becoming indispensable in enhancing operational efficiency and decision-making accuracy. Their integration into systems allows for rapid pattern recognition, quality control, and predictive analytics, making them a cornerstone of modern technological infrastructure from medical diagnostics to autonomous vehicles.

Artificial Intelligence Integration: The Primary Growth Engine
The report identifies the pervasive integration of artificial intelligence and machine learning as the paramount driver for image processing module demand. With the AI in computer vision market itself experiencing explosive growth, the correlation is direct and substantial. The demand for real-time analytics in applications ranging from factory automation to medical screening is creating unprecedented need for these specialized hardware and software solutions.
"The massive concentration of technology developers and manufacturing hubs in the Asia-Pacific region, which consumes a significant portion of global image processing modules, is a key factor in the market's dynamism," the report states. With global investments in smart manufacturing and Industry 4.0 technologies exceeding hundreds of billions through 2030, the demand for advanced image processing capabilities is set to intensify, especially with the transition to more complex applications requiring sub-millisecond response times.

Emerging Opportunities in Autonomous Systems and Edge Computing
Beyond traditional drivers, the report outlines significant emerging opportunities. The rapid expansion of autonomous vehicle development and edge computing infrastructure presents new growth avenues, requiring sophisticated image processing capabilities in production processes. Furthermore, the integration of IoT and 5G technologies is a major trend. Smart image processing modules with real-time analytics capabilities can reduce processing latency by up to 70% and improve decision-making accuracy significantly.
